Bilbao hospitality vouchers: Vouchers are launched to help the Bilbao hospitality industry | Radio Bilbao

The mayor of Bilbao has presented the bonus campaign aimed at the hospitality sector that will start this Monday, March 15. It is the first time that the bond model has been used in this sector, which has led to the creation of a specific web platform for its management and execution through www.bonobilbao.eus. Unlike previous campaigns, on this occasion citizens must select the establishment at the time of purchase of the voucher on the web. After the purchase, and even if the customer has not yet made the consumption, the hotelier / a will receive 50% of the amount of each one. That is to say, the part of the City Council. Each establishment may receive a maximum of 6,000 euros in vouchers exchanged.

554 businesses have joined, to this day, something that for the mayor can be read by some as that “only 25% have joined when we can say that 25% have already joined “. Remember Juan Mari Aburto that the vouchers will be 10 and 20 euros and, as in previous campaigns, the amount of the ticket must be equal to or greater than the amount of the vouchers, in such a way that it is completely exhausted in each consumption. They are compatible and cumulative with any other type of voucher launched by the different administrations.

The first mayor recalled that “With the aim of quickly getting the aid to the different establishments, the payments will be made weekly”, so that “first the 50% deposit will be made after the purchase of the voucher and the income of the other 50% later when the customer makes the consumption. “The Mayor insisted in the presentation of the plan that is activated next Monday that” this campaign has a very special value, because we know the suffering that the sector of the hospitality industry and their families. “In his opinion,” it is a challenge because it is the first time that the bond model has been used in this sector. “

The deadline to acquire the bonds will end on June 30, but there will be one more month to exchange them. In addition, Aburto wanted to remember that the limit of vouchers per person is 20 for the four campaigns (commerce, culture, hospitality and tourism) and that the maximum per purchase ticket is four vouchers. In total, it will be one million euros to help the hospitality industry and an economic impact of 3.4 million euros is expected.

Rwith regard to the campaign of direct aid to the hospitality industry which was launched by the City Council in December, there were 2,053 applications and, to date, a total of 1907 have been resolved and paid, as confirmed by the Mayor.
